Releases: ansys/pyaedt
Releases · ansys/pyaedt
v0.8.2
What's Changed
- use 0.0.0.0 as hostname for rpyc servers by @ansAFinney in #4294
- Improved way info can be read and written in Virtual Compliance by @maxcapodi78 in #4299
- Add lazy load flag by @Samuelopez-ansys in #4298
- bug fix virtual compliance report by @ring630 in #4303
- Fix/issue 4122 by @Samuelopez-ansys in #4307
- TESTS: Refact warnings filtering by @SMoraisAnsys in #4297
- fix view and plot label in plot_field_from_fieldplot by @gmalinve in #4293
- improve speedup of Modeler by @maxcapodi78 in #4309
- fix export_field_file on grid by @gmalinve in #4308
- Update 2024 r1 CI and Examples by @Samuelopez-ansys in #4310
- Disable EMIT tests 2024R1 by @Samuelopez-ansys in #4316
- Circuit vpwl by @boyang2022 in #4317
- MAINT: Bump matplotlib from 3.5.3 to 3.8.3 by @dependabot in #4327
- MAINT: Bump pytest from 7.4.2 to 8.0.2 by @dependabot in #4325
- MAINT: Bump pypandoc from 1.11 to 1.13 by @dependabot in #4324
- MAINT: Bump pyvista from 0.42.2 to 0.43.3 by @dependabot in #4326
- docs: Remove any specifics about AEDT vs EDB API. by @MaxJPRey in #4328
- Created Virtual Compliance example by @maxcapodi78 in #4322
- Move dotnet dependencies by @Samuelopez-ansys in #4329
- Do not rename built-in 'dir'. by @MaxJPRey in #4333
- maint: Remove references to old files that were removed. by @MaxJPRey in #4332
- MAINT: Bump rpyc from 5.3.1 to 6.0.0 by @dependabot in #4321
- passivity causality check by @svandenb-dev in #4319
- set dictionary circuit components by @gmalinve in #4330
- MAINT: Bump ansys-sphinx-theme from 0.13.1 to 0.14.0 by @dependabot in #4336
- MAINT: Bump pytest-xdist from 3.3.1 to 3.5.0 by @dependabot in #4339
- MAINT: Bump numpy from 1.26.0 to 1.26.4 by @dependabot in #4337
- MAINT: Bump sphinx-autobuild from 2021.3.14 to 2024.2.4 by @dependabot in #4338
- install motor toolkit by @gmalinve in #3724
- Fix angle in degrees example by @Samuelopez-ansys in #4340
- Enhance Icepak default templates by @lorenzovecchietti in #4265
New Contributors
- @ansAFinney made their first contribution in #4294
Full Changelog: v0.8.1...v0.8.2
v0.8.1
Full Changelog: v0.8.0...v0.8.1
v0.8.0
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#4223
- Reference cs for 3dlayout comp import by @ring630 in #4212
- Added ERL computation in Circuit through SPISIM launched in non-graphical mode by @maxcapodi78 in #4219
- Maxwell impedance BC can now be assigned to faces as well, improved docstring by @IreneWoyna in #4229
- New feature from 24.1 - via_mesh_plating by @ring630 in #4233
- fix: declare regex as raw string to avoid escape sequence deprecation by @JonathanRayner in #4239
- export_to_3d_design_with_via_hole by @ring630 in #4241
- fix q3d dynamic link by @gmalinve in #4220
- fix freq sweep and deprecate q3d method by @gmalinve in #4235
- Changed info message wording: by @IreneWoyna in #4246
- set solve_inside to False for pec, added a unit test by @IreneWoyna in #4231
- 4199 sweep along vector issue by @amichel0205 in #4250
- added erl parameter to VirtualCompliance by @maxcapodi78 in #4234
- Design dataset 'delete' function fixed by @Ouam74 in #4263
- change button text cir comp by @gmalinve in #4267
- Maint/replace edb with pyedb by @maxcapodi78 in #4269
- Enhancement/icepak postprocessing by @lorenzovecchietti in #4259
- Fix & Improvement to parametric heatsink function by @lorenzovecchietti in #4226
- Update MIT license URL. by @MaxJPRey in #4262
- add digits format plot by @gmalinve in #4266
- Remove WPF method in PyAEDT by @Samuelopez-ansys in #4275
- Maxwell Icepak 2-way coupling example by @IreneWoyna in #4243
- Update README.md by @jsalant22 in #4276
- Refactored IcepakPostProcessor to include advanced features with pyvista and numpy by @maxcapodi78 in #4277
- CI: Fix documentation workflow by @SMoraisAnsys in #4280
- MAINT: Depecrate python version 3.7 by @SMoraisAnsys in #4281
- CI: Update workflows runs-on by @SMoraisAnsys in #4285
- Add custom LSF by @Samuelopez-ansys in #4290
- refacto examples by @gmalinve in #4221
- Feat/issue 4053 by @Samuelopez-ansys in #4056
- New dev version by @Samuelopez-ansys in #4279
New Contributors
- @JonathanRayner made their first contribution in #4239
- @Ouam74 made their first contribution in #4263
Full Changelog: v0.7.12...v0.8.0
v0.7.12
What's Changed
- remove illegal character from variable name before variable creation by @ring630 in #4168
- improve m2d DC Conduction example - pdf report by @gmalinve in #4188
- MAINT: Bump codecov/codecov-action from 3 to 4 by @dependabot in #4165
- Move virtual compliance and pdf test to _unittest_solvers by @Samuelopez-ansys in #4195
- Fix create fieldplot surface by @gmalinve in #4191
- Add toml support by @maxcapodi78 in #4189
- fix delete single pin rlc by @gmalinve in #4207
- CI: track changes in examples by @SMoraisAnsys in #4211
- Add tdr report by @maxcapodi78 in #4206
Full Changelog: v0.7.11...v0.7.12
v0.7.11
What's Changed
- CI: fix labeler to match v5 structure by @SMoraisAnsys in #4087
- Fix ac example by @Samuelopez-ansys in #4088
- CI: fix full documentation upload step by @SMoraisAnsys in #4089
- Json schema lib dependency fix by @svandenb-dev in #4090
- Update full_documentation.yml by @Samuelopez-ansys in #4091
- Fix desktop reference counting by @isaacansys in #4094
- Icepak csv example improvement by @lorenzovecchietti in #4100
- issue-4102-reverting-implementation-in-get_scalar_field_value by @nnetake in #4103
- MAINT: fix CI by fixing scipy and scikit-rf versions by @SMoraisAnsys in #4118
- fix q2d cable example by @gmalinve in #4108
- new function: start continue from previous setup by @IreneWoyna in #4065
- remove edb json configuration support by @ring630 in #4086
- added DCConduction and ACConduction design types and solution setups.… by @IreneWoyna in #4123
- TEST: add test on create polygon by @svandenb-dev in #4116
- doc string fix by @svandenb-dev in #4120
- Polygon operations added by @svandenb-dev in #4127
- MAINT: Bump peter-evans/create-or-update-comment from 3 to 4 by @dependabot in #4138
- MAINT: use scikit-rf 0.31.0 by @SMoraisAnsys in #4139
- fixes q3d dynamic component link by @gmalinve in #4135
- MISC: add logger error when object not found by @SMoraisAnsys in #4147
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#4151
- MISC: follow pyansys repo guidelines by @SMoraisAnsys in #4141
- Linear step sweep by @gmalinve in #4158
- MAINT: Bump nick-fields/retry from 2 to 3 by @dependabot in #4164
- Update readme and broken links by @dipinknair in #4166
- issue_4170_bug_resolution by @nnetake in #4174
- test design types and boundaries by @gmalinve in #4172
- Create new function to import GDS file in HFSS by @amichel0205 in #4142
- fix boundary delete by @gmalinve in #4175
- sDesktopinstallDirectory is now set also for remote sessions by @Alberto-DM in #4183
- Fix Icepak examples by @Samuelopez-ansys in #4182
- export field file fix by @gmalinve in #4163
- added method to AnsysReport to retrieve design Info by @maxcapodi78 in #4146
- added pyclient support by @maxcapodi78 in #4145
- Implemented new VirtualCompliance class to generate automatically reports by @maxcapodi78 in #4176
- DOC: Update documentation by @dipinknair in #4181
New Contributors
- @dipinknair made their first contribution in #4166
Full Changelog: v0.7.10...v0.7.11
v0.7.10
What's Changed
- Add q3d dynamic link component by @gmalinve in #4069
- Fix examples by @Samuelopez-ansys in #4076
- CI: extend full documentation timeout by @SMoraisAnsys in #4071
- Q2D cable example by @tizianrot in #4000
- Add
get_sweeps
anddelete_sweep
toSetupHFSS
by @atlanswer in #4072 - Pingroup name conflict resolution by @svandenb-dev in #4074
- Edb config json enhancement by @ring630 in #4079
- component.create() metod rlc values and location bug fix by @svandenb-dev in #4083
Full Changelog: v0.7.9...v0.7.10
v0.7.9
What's Changed
- Fixed Docstring #3970 by @DaveTwyman in #3985
- Example fixed by @svandenb-dev in #4007
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#4008
- Feat/4011 3dcomp folder by @dcrawforAtAnsys in #4013
- Update the documentation of general methods. by @MaxJPRey in #4016
- Update variables.rst by @FH-DESIGN in #4009
- Feat/4010 pass primitive features by @dcrawforAtAnsys in #4019
- Fix typos in docstring. by @MaxJPRey in #4022
- Enhancement/add configuration schema by @dcrawforAtAnsys in #3994
- fix to read mesh operation and mesh region properly for 2024R1 by @siva-krishnaswamy in #4015
- Enhancement/allow 3dcomp file loading by @siva-krishnaswamy in #4027
- pyvista parallel projection by @ring630 in #4031
- New pdf report by @maxcapodi78 in #4030
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#4039
- Cleanup examples (remove unused imports and fix typos) by @MaxJPRey in #4038
- Path length correction by @svandenb-dev in #4035
- stackup import enhancement by @ring630 in #3989
- Refactor ffd solution data by @Samuelopez-ansys in #3896
- Cutout return polygon extent by @svandenb-dev in #4046
- Improve convert via to 3d by @amichel0205 in #4028
- New 3D Layout example on PCI-E SYZ analysis by @ring630 in #4048
- Ipc exporter false error issue by @svandenb-dev in #4043
- modified \pyaedt\pyaedt\modules\SetupTemplates.py by @ANSYS-KOREA in #4054
- Component is top by @svandenb-dev in #4052
- Refactoring of aedt logger by @maxcapodi78 in #4025
- group_name property gets updates from the UI by @Alberto-DM in #4057
- Refactor user guide by @Samuelopez-ansys in #4055
- set up Edb from json configure file by @ring630 in #4059
- Create port on pin name selection adjustment by @svandenb-dev in #4061
- DOC: Update ansys-sphinx-theme to fix documentation build by @SMoraisAnsys in #4068
- Fix native component loading by @lorenzovecchietti in #4067
- Fix Examples documentation by @Samuelopez-ansys in #4070
New Contributors
- @FH-DESIGN made their first contribution in #4009
- @ANSYS-KOREA made their first contribution in #4054
Full Changelog: v0.7.8...v0.7.9
v0.7.8
What's Changed
- MAINT: Bump actions/labeler from 4 to 5 by @dependabot in #3943
- added "DecadeCount" "OctaveCount" "ExponentialCount" in parametric sw… by @IreneWoyna in #3910
- Added skip for unit tests that fail when running AEDT with COM by @Alberto-DM in #3953
- Bug fix merge nets polygon by @svandenb-dev in #3950
- layout profile added to IPC2581 by @svandenb-dev in #3957
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#3963
- MAINT: Bump actions/setup-python from 4 to 5 by @dependabot in #3954
- Create via fence bug fix by @ring630 in #3961
- Return basis frequencies with the default units. by @Samuelopez-ansys in #3966
- Edb sip format import added by @svandenb-dev in #3959
- add solve setup type siwave DC IR by @gmalinve in #3971
- Replace all os.name with boolean checks is_windows, is_linux by @kbhagat-ansys in #3956
- Support pec port on pin and rlc component by @svandenb-dev in #3944
- Create connector from pin example by @svandenb-dev in #3973
- variations cases in create_report and get_solution_data by @gmalinve in #3972
- Adding padstackinstance terminal position getter by @svandenb-dev in #3977
- Improve Nissan Leaf example by @gmalinve in #3984
- New conducting plate function by @lorenzovecchietti in #3980
- create object cs in example by @gmalinve in #3991
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#3996
- MAINT: Bump actions/download-artifact from 3 to 4 by @dependabot in #3987
- MAINT: Bump actions/upload-artifact from 3 to 4 by @dependabot in #3986
- MAINT: update ansys action to v5 by @SMoraisAnsys in #3999
- Make license session test more consistent and meaningful by @bryankaylor in #3995
- Ipc bom by @svandenb-dev in #3990
- Layout auto parametrization by @svandenb-dev in #4002
- Do not use empty list as default parameter value. by @MaxJPRey in #4004
- Fix typo in IBIS spec, 'seeries' to 'series' by @GarrStau in #4006
- core loss example by @gmalinve in #3997
Full Changelog: v0.7.7...v0.7.8
v0.7.7
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#3918
- Add transient options to stationary wall boundary condition by @lorenzovecchietti in #3921
- Improve variations in create_report by @gmalinve in #3924
- Assign FEBI method by @Samuelopez-ansys in #3915
- Fix parameter check in
create_frequency_sweep
& add related test by @atlanswer in #3929 - Fix
KeyError
inenable_adaptive_setup_multifrequency
by @atlanswer in #3930 - Emit license session by @bryankaylor in #3856
- Apply mesh sheets obj segmentation by @gmalinve in #3932
- Fix netlist issues by @Samuelopez-ansys in #3938
- fix doc example in set_coreloss_at_frequency by @gmalinve in #3937
- extended net minor fix by @ring630 in #3919
- Bugfix on Surface material creation and value_with_units by @Alberto-DM in #3942
- Add resistance boundary by @lorenzovecchietti in #3946
- Bug fix refresh padsatck def after layer name changed by @svandenb-dev in #3939
- Improve desktop launch by @Alberto-DM in #3947
- Monitors and datasets import/export improvements by @lorenzovecchietti in #3917
New Contributors
- @atlanswer made their first contribution in #3929
Full Changelog: v0.7.6...v0.7.7
v0.7.6
What's Changed
- DOC: Explain how to contribute in details in the CONTRIBUTION.md file. by @MaxJPRey in #3891
- Fix touchstone deepcopy issue by @Samuelopez-ansys in #3892
- Fix pythoncom issue by @Samuelopez-ansys in #3900
- Fix bug in disjoint_nets method due to a regression in the net_name setter by @maxcapodi78 in #3897
- Improve method get_solution_data to avoid intrinsics as arguments and… by @maxcapodi78 in #3898
- Core loss electrical steel by @gmalinve in #3829
- Adds methods to set band start and stop frequencies, & corresponding unit tests by @zebanaqviWAT in #3773
- Solder balls height control with simconfig by @svandenb-dev in #3905
Full Changelog: v0.7.5...v0.7.6